Arsip: filter field datetime tanggal dan bulan

more 16 years ago
putra_wlh
Ada yg bisa bantu..
saya ingin memfilter field datetime menurut taggal dan bulan saja pada SQLServer menggunakan Delphi 7 dengan BDE. saya sudah mencoba beberapa cara menggunakan Query maupun Table di antaranya:
1. Dengan menggunakan table pada event OnFilterRecord
tgl := FormatDateTime('DD/MMM', Date);
s := DataSet['tgl'];
Accept := s = QuotedStr(tgl);
2. pada button saya beri variabel dengan nilai yg di sesuaikan pada event onFilterRecord
3. dataset di beri value.
4. pada table di tentukan fieldnya
5. Dengan menggunakan Query menggnakan parameter pada tangal
if Query1.paramByName('tgl').AsString = FormatDateTime('DD/MMM', Date) then
Query1.Open
6. pernah juga di beri copy (dah lieur pisan jigana mah.. hueuuehehehe..)
6. dan masih banyak lagi klo di tulis smuanya ga kan slesai...
field tgl sudah di set menjadi string atau value dengan menggunakn table maupun query tetap mengalami error..
Mohon Bantuannya.....

more 16 years ago
ichan29
sederhana sebenernya, cuman dikau ngga baca di help SQLServer nya..
manfaatkan fungsi month dan year
decodedate(tanggal,tahun,bulan,hari)
select * from table where year(tanggal)='+QutoedStr(inttostr(tahun))+
' and month(tanggal)='+QuotedStr(inttostr(bulan));
kurang lebih seperti itu, kembangkan sendiri sesuai dg yg dimaksud
more 16 years ago
ichan29
eh sorry, yg ditanya adalah bulan dan hari ya..
select * from table where month(tanggal)='+QutoedStr(inttostr(bulan))+
' and day(tanggal)='+QuotedStr(inttostr(hari));
tp klo buat periode tinggal hari mulai dari sampai dg... tau kan.
more 16 years ago
ir1keren
sklian klo mo filter dengan range bulan dan taon tertentu, misal dari bulan 01/04 ampe 07/05
'select * from table where (month(tanggal) between '+QuotedStr(IntTostr(bulan_1))+' AND '+
QuotedStr(IntToStr(bulan_2))+') AND (day(tanggal) between '+QuotedStr(IntToStr(tanggal_1))+
' AND '+QuotedStr(IntToStr(tanggal_2))+')'

more 15 years ago
putra_wlh
Master2..
terima kasih jawabannya...
sudah d coba pada query di delphi untuk SQLServer menggunakan BDE..
Memang klo d SQL Explorer Delphi ataupun SQLServernya bisa...
hanya saja setelah d coba pada Query d Delphi hasilnya Optimizer Lock Hints.
Setelah itu saa coba ubah dengan berbagai macam cara tapi tetep aja hasilnya sama, atau error pada code yang saya ubah...
bagaimana seharusnya untuk menangani Optimizer Lock Hints...

more 15 years ago
putra_wlh
Yaa...
sudah berhasil...
setelah coba di ulang dari awal lagi semuanya baru bisa...
hehehe... ;p
:oops:
more ...
- Pages:
- 1
reply |
Report Obsolete
AI Forward

🚀 We're thrilled to partner with Alibaba Cloud for "AI Forward - Alibaba Cloud Global Developer Summit 2025" in Jakarta! Join us and explore the future of AI. Register now:
https://int.alibabacloud.com/m/1000400772/
#AlibabaCloud #DeveloperSummit #Jakarta #AIFORWARD
Last Articles
Last Topic
- PascalTalk #6: (Podcast) Kuliah IT di luar negeri, susah gak sih?
by LuriDarmawan in Tutorial & Community Project more 4 years ago - PascalTalk #5: UX: Research, Design and Engineer
by LuriDarmawan in Tutorial & Community Project more 4 years ago - PascalTalk #4: Obrolan Ringan Seputar IT
by LuriDarmawan in Tutorial & Community Project more 4 years ago - PascalTalk #2: Membuat Sendiri SMART HOME
by LuriDarmawan in Tutorial & Community Project more 4 years ago - PascalTalk #3: RADically Fast and Easy Mobile Apps Development with Delphi
by LuriDarmawan in Tutorial & Community Project more 4 years ago - PascalTalk #1: Pemanfaatan Artificial Intelligence di Masa Covid-19
by LuriDarmawan in Tutorial & Community Project more 4 years ago - Tempat Latihan Posting
by LuriDarmawan in OOT more 5 years ago - Archive
- Looping lagi...
by idhiel in Hal umum tentang Pascal Indonesia more 12 years ago - [ask] koneksi ke ODBC user Dsn saat runtime dengan ado
by halimanh in FireBird more 12 years ago - Validasi menggunakan data tanggal
by mas_kofa in Hal umum tentang Pascal Indonesia more 12 years ago
Random Topic
- Menangkap argument yang dikirim saat start aplikasi
by yosstefano in Tip n Trik Pemrograman more 18 years ago - Masalah DbXpress dan QuickReport
by sepoix in Reporting more 16 years ago - nge-set date
by nurez in Hal umum tentang Pascal Indonesia more 17 years ago - Cara mengganti isi file.txt
by binyo in Network, Files, I/O & System more 12 years ago - GIS
by p2bf in Enginering more 17 years ago - Eventkeypressnya Kok Gak Bisa?
by cyber2000 in Tip n Trik Pemrograman more 15 years ago - ginana koneksi ke DB pake file INI?
by putukaca in Tip n Trik Pemrograman more 17 years ago - mengeluarkan suara dengan frekuensi tertentu?
by gormet in Enginering more 19 years ago - [help] database client server pake mysql xampp...
by binyo in MySQL more 12 years ago - [ASK] Enkripsi yang enak buat Config..
by lord_kimm in Tutorial & Community Project more 18 years ago